Output 96374fd83d23b0acb6b4c100936d2cad46be147853254c3ff9e43507991112b5:1

value
645183501
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df0b22240db2824f36ab21524be9441f71bef69e OP_EQUALVERIFY OP_CHECKSIG
address
DRUSZbXwNZYfdTErEUBujzM89A1b8BJkNY
transaction
96374fd83d23b0acb6b4c100936d2cad46be147853254c3ff9e43507991112b5